What is the weather of Lexington Maria, San Jose, CA?
Lexington Maria experiences a Mediterranean climate characterized by warm, dry summers and mild, wet winters. Average summer temperatures range from the mid-80s to low 90s °F, while winter temperatures usually range from the mid-40s to mid-60s °F. Rainfall primarily occurs from November to March.
